CONTINGENT VALUE RIGHTS AGREEMENT

 

THIS CONTINGENT VALUE RIGHTS AGREEMENT, dated as of July 18, 2019 (this “Agreement”), is entered into by and among Elanco Animal Health Incorporated, a Indiana corporation (“Parent”), Broadridge Corporate Issuer Solutions, Inc., a Pennsylvania corporation, as initial Rights Agent (as defined herein), and UMB Bank, National Association, a national banking association duly organized and existing and in good standing under the laws of the United States of America, solely in its capacity as Holders’ Representative (as defined herein).

 

PREAMBLE

 

WHEREAS, Parent, Elanco Athens Inc., a Delaware corporation and a direct wholly owned subsidiary of Parent (“Acquisition Sub”), and Aratana Therapeutics, Inc., a Delaware corporation (the “Company”), have entered into an Agreement and Plan of Merger, dated as of April 26,2019 (the “Merger Agreement”), pursuant to which Acquisition Sub will merge with and into the Company (the “Merger”) and the Company will survive the Merger as a wholly owned subsidiary of Parent, all upon the terms and subject to the conditions set forth in the Merger Agreement;

 

WHEREAS, pursuant to the Merger Agreement, and in accordance with the terms and conditions thereof, Parent has agreed to provide to the Holders (as defined herein) CVRs (as defined herein) as hereinafter described;

 

WHEREAS, pursuant to the Merger Agreement, by approving the Merger Agreement and the transactions contemplated thereby, or by executing and delivering a letter of transmittal, the Holders have appointed the Holders’ Representative as the exclusive agent and attorney-in-fact on behalf of each Holder with respect to this Agreement and any agreement contemplated hereby, and authorized the Holders’ Representative to take any and all actions and make any decisions required or permitted to be taken by such Holders’ Representative pursuant to this Agreement; and

 

WHEREAS, the parties have done all things necessary to make the CVRs, when issued pursuant to the Merger Agreement and hereunder, the valid obligations of Parent and to make this Agreement a valid and binding agreement of Parent, in accordance with its terms.

 

NOW, THEREFORE, in consideration of the foregoing premises and the consummation of the transactions referred to above, it is mutually covenanted and agreed, for the proportionate benefit of all Holders, as follows:

Milestone” means the first occurrence and only the first occurrence of either (i) the sum of (A) the cumulative Net Sales of the Product during the First Sales Measurement Period, plus (B) the Imputed Net Sales (if any) equaling or exceeding $25,000,000, or (ii) the sum of (A) the cumulative Net Sales of the Product during the Second Sales Measurement Period, plus (B) the Imputed Net Sales (if any) equaling or exceeding $50,000,000.

 

Milestone Achievement Certificate” has the meaning set forth in Section 2.4(a).

 

Milestone Non-Achievement Certificate” has the meaning set forth in Section 2.4(c).

 

Milestone Payment” means $0.25 per CVR.

 

Milestone Payment Amount” means, for a given Holder, the product of (a) the Milestone Payment and (b) the number of CVRs held by such Holder as reflected on the CVR Register as of the close of business on the date of the applicable Milestone Achievement Certificate (or if, in accordance with Section 4.4, the Independent Accountant prepares a Final Shortfall Report that concludes that the Milestone Payment should have been paid but was not paid when due, as of the close of business on the date of the Final Shortfall Report, as the case may be).

 

Milestone Payment Date” means the date that is forty-five (45) days following the last day of the applicable Sales Measurement Period.

 

Net Sales” means the gross amount invoiced by the Selling Entities (without double counting) to third parties other than any other Selling Entity (except as provided below), for the Product, less (without double counting):

 

(1) trade, quantity and cash discounts allowed;

 

(2) discounts, refunds, rebates, chargebacks, retroactive price adjustments, and any other allowances which effectively reduce the net selling price;

 

(3) product returns and allowances;

 

(4) that portion of the sales value associated with Drug Delivery Systems;

 

4


 

(5) any tax imposed on the production, sale, delivery or use of the Product, including, without limitation, sales, use, excise or value added taxes;

 

(6) wholesaler inventory management fees;

 

(7) allowance for distribution expenses (other than distribution expenses incurred by any Selling Entity); and

 

(8) any other similar and customary deductions which are in accordance with GAAP (collectively, the “Permitted Deductions”).

 

Such amounts shall be determined from the books and records of such Selling Entity, maintained in accordance with GAAP, consistently applied, and using Parent’s then current standard procedures and methodology, including Parent’s then current standard exchange rate methodology for the translation of foreign currency sales into U.S. Dollars, consistently applied.

 

In the case of any sale of the Product between or among any of the Selling Entities for resale, Net Sales shall be calculated as above only on the value charged or invoiced on the first bona fide arm’s-length sale thereafter to a third party, less the Permitted Deductions; provided, however that, where the purchasing Selling Entity is an end-user of, and does not further sell, the Product, Net Sales shall be calculated on the value charged or invoiced to such purchasing Selling Entity, less the Permitted Deductions, in each case as determined in accordance with the foregoing paragraph. If a Product is sold or otherwise commercially disposed of for consideration other than cash or in a transaction that is not at arm’s length between the buyer of such Product and the applicable Selling Entity, then the gross amount to be included in the calculation of Net Sales shall be the amount that would have been received had the transaction been conducted at arm’s length and for cash. Such amount that would have been received shall be determined, wherever possible, by reference to the weighted average selling price of such Product in arm’s length transactions as defined below.

 

In the event that the Product is sold as part of a Combination Product (a “Combination Sale”), the Net Sales of the Product shall be determined by multiplying the Net Sales of the Combination Product by the fraction, A / (A+B) where A is the weighted average sale price of the Product when sold separately in finished form, and B is the weighted average sale price of the other product(s) sold separately in finished form.

 

In the event that the weighted average sale price of the Product can be determined but the weighted average sale price of the other product(s) cannot be determined, Net Sales shall be calculated by multiplying the Net Sales of the Combination Product by the fraction A / C where A is the weighted average sale price of the Product when sold separately in finished form and C is the weighted average sale price of the Combination Product.

 

In the event that the weighted average sale price of the other product(s) can be determined but the weighted average sale price of the Product cannot be determined, Net Sales shall be calculated by multiplying the Net Sales of the Combination Product by the following formula: one (1) minus (B / C) where B is the weighted average sale price of the other product(s) when sold separately in finished form and C is the weighted average sale price of the Combination Product.

 

5


 

In the event that the weighted average sale price cannot be determined for the Product and all other product(s) included in the Combination Product, Net Sales shall be deemed to be equal to fifty percent (50%) of the Net Sales of the Combination Product.

 

The weighted average sale price for a Product, other product(s), or Combination Product shall be calculated once each calendar year, and such weighted average sale price shall be used for such Product, other product(s), or Combination Product during that applicable calendar year. When determining the weighted average sale price of a Product, other product(s), or Combination Product, the weighted average sale price shall be calculated by dividing the sales dollars (translated into U.S. dollars) of such Product, other product(s), or Combination Product by the units of such Product, other product(s), or Combination Product sold during the twelve (12) months (or the number of months sold in a partial calendar year) of the preceding calendar year for the respective Product, other product(s), or Combination Product. In the initial calendar year that such Product, other product(s), or Combination Product is sold, a good-faith forecasted weighted average sale price determined by Parent will be used for the Product, other product(s), or Combination Product.

ARTICLE 2
CONTINGENT VALUE RIGHTS

 

Section 2.1                                    Holders of CVRs; Appointment of Rights Agent.

 

(a)                                 As provided in the Merger Agreement, and subject to the terms thereof, the initial Holders shall be the holders of shares of Company Common Stock (other than (i) Cancelled Company Shares and (ii) any Dissenting Company Shares) immediately prior to the Effective Time that are validly converted into the Merger Consideration pursuant to Section 2.1(a) of the Merger Agreement.

 

(b)                                 Parent hereby appoints the Rights Agent to act as rights agent for Parent in accordance with the express terms and conditions set forth in this Agreement, and the Rights Agent hereby accepts such appointment.

 

Section 2.2                                    Non-transferable.

 

A Holder may not Transfer any CVRs, other than pursuant to a Permitted Transfer or if a Holder is abandoning its CVRs pursuant to Section 2.6.  Any attempted Transfer that is not a Permitted Transfer, in whole or in part, will be void ab initio and of no effect.

 

8


 

Section 2.3                                    No Certificate; Registration; Registration of Transfer; Change of Address.

 

(a)                                 Holders’ rights and obligations in respect of CVRs derive solely from this Agreement; CVRs will not be evidenced by a certificate or other instrument.

 

(b)                                 The Rights Agent will maintain an up-to-date register (the “CVR Register”) for the purposes of the registration of the CVRs and Permitted Transfers thereof in a book-entry position for each Holder.  The CVR Register shall set forth the name and address of each Holder, the number of CVRs held by such Holder, and the U.S. federal tax identification number of each Holder. The CVR Register will initially show one position for Cede & Co. representing all the shares of Company Common Stock held by DTC on behalf of the street holders of the shares of Company Common Stock held by such holders as of immediately prior to the Effective Time.

 

(c)                                  Subject to the restriction on transferability set forth in Section 2.2, every request made to Transfer CVRs must be in writing and accompanied by a written instrument of Transfer duly executed and properly completed, as applicable, by the Holder or Holders thereof, or by the duly appointed legal representative, personal representative or survivor of such Holder or Holders, setting forth in reasonable detail the circumstances relating to the Transfer.  Upon receipt of such written notice, the Rights Agent will, subject to its reasonable determination in accordance with its own internal procedures, (i) determine if (A) the Transfer instrument is in proper form, (B) the Transfer is a Permitted Transfer and (C) the Transfer otherwise complies on its face with the other terms and conditions of this Agreement, and, if so (ii) register the Transfer of the applicable CVRs in the CVR Register.  All Transfers of CVRs registered in the CVR Register will be the valid obligations of Parent, evidencing the same right, and entitling the transferee to the same benefits and rights under this Agreement, as those held by the transferor.  No Transfer of CVRs shall be valid until registered in the CVR Register in accordance with this Agreement and any Transfer not duly registered in the CVR Register shall be void.

 

(d)                                 A Holder may make a written request to the Rights Agent to change such Holder’s address of record in the CVR Register.  Such written request must be duly executed by such Holder.  Upon receipt of such written notice, the Rights Agent shall promptly record the change of address in the CVR Register.

 

Section 2.4                                    Payment Procedures.

 

(a)                                 If the Milestone occurs prior to the expiration of a Sales Measurement Period, then, on or prior to the Milestone Payment Date, Parent, will (i) deliver to the Rights Agent and the Holders’ Representative, an Officer’s Certificate certifying the date of the occurrence of the Milestone and that the Holders are entitled to receive the Milestone Payment (the “Milestone Achievement Certificate”), (ii) deliver any letter of instruction reasonably required by the Rights Agent and (iii) deposit with the Rights Agent, in trust for the benefit of the Holders, the aggregate amount necessary to pay the Milestone Payment Amount to each Holder. As promptly as practicable after the Rights Agent’s receipt of the Milestone Achievement Certificate, any letter of instruction reasonably required by the Rights Agent and the aggregate amount necessary to pay the Milestone Payment Amount to each Holder (and in any event, within ten (10) Business Days after receipt), the Rights Agent shall (A) deliver, or

 

9


 

cause to be delivered, by first-class postage prepaid mail, to each Holder at the address of such Holder set forth in the CVR Register as of the close of business on the date of the Milestone Achievement Certificate, a copy of the Milestone Achievement Certificate and (B) pay or cause to be paid, by check delivered by first-class postage prepaid mail, to each Holder at the address of such Holder set forth in the CVR Register as of the close of business on the date of the Milestone Achievement Certificate, the Milestone Payment Amount payable to such Holder, less any applicable withholding pursuant to Section 2.4(d).

 

(b)                                 If the Milestone has not occurred prior to the expiration of a Sales Measurement Period then, on or before the date that is forty-five (45) days after the end of such Sales Measurement Period, Parent will deliver to the Rights Agent and the Holders’ Representative (i) an Officer’s Certificate certifying that the applicable Milestone has not occurred in the immediately preceding Sales Measurement Period and that Parent has complied in all material respects with its obligations under this Agreement (the “Milestone Non-Achievement Certificate”), and (ii) the Net Sales Statement for such Sales Measurement Period.  The Rights Agent will promptly (and in any event, within ten (10) Business Days after receipt) deliver, or cause to be delivered, by first-class postage prepaid mail, to each Holder at the address of such Holder set forth in the CVR Register as of the close of business on the date of the Milestone Non-Achievement Certificate, a copy of such Milestone Non-Achievement Certificate and the Net Sales Statement for such Sales Measurement Period.  The Rights Agent will deliver to Parent a certificate certifying the date of delivery of such certificate to the Holders.

 

(c)                                  Except to the extent any portion of any Milestone Payment Amount is required to be treated as imputed interest pursuant to applicable Law, the parties hereto agree to treat any Milestone Payment Amount as additional consideration for the shares of Company Common Stock for all U.S. federal and applicable state and local income Tax purposes.  The parties hereto will not take any position to the contrary on any Tax Return except as required by applicable Law.

 

(d)                                 Parent and the Rights Agent will be entitled to deduct and withhold, or cause to be deducted and withheld, from any Milestone Payment Amount otherwise payable pursuant to this Agreement, such amounts as it is required to deduct and withhold with respect to the making of such payment under any provision of applicable Law relating to Taxes.  To the extent that amounts are so deducted and withheld, such deducted and withheld amounts will be treated for all purposes of this Agreement as having been paid to the Holder in respect of which such deduction and withholding was made and, in no event shall either Parent or the Rights Agent be obligated to pay additional amounts in respect of any such deduction or withholding.  Prior to making any such Tax deductions or withholdings or causing any such Tax deductions or withholdings to be made with respect to any Holder, the Rights Agent will, to the extent reasonably practicable, provide notice to the Holder of such potential Tax deduction or withholding and a reasonable opportunity for the Holder to provide any necessary Tax forms in order to avoid or reduce such withholding amounts; provided, however, that the time period for payment of a Milestone Payment Amount by the Rights Agent set forth in Section 2.4(a) will be extended by a period equal to any delay caused by the Holder providing such forms, provided, further, that in no event shall such period be extended for more than ten (10) Business Days, unless specifically requested by the Holder for the purpose of delivering such forms and agreed to by the Rights Agent in its sole discretion.  Except as provided in this Section 2.4(f), none of

 

10


 

Parent or any of its Affiliates shall have any right to set off any amounts owed or claimed to be owed by any Holder to any of them against such Holder’s Milestone Payment Amount or other amount payable to such Holder in respect of the CVRs.

 

(e)                                  Any portion of any Milestone Payment Amount that remains undistributed to the Holders twelve (12) months after the applicable Milestone Payment Date (including by means of uncashed checks or invalid addresses on the CVR Register) will be delivered by the Rights Agent to Parent or a person nominated in writing by Parent (with written notice thereof from Parent to the Rights Agent), and any Holder will thereafter look only to Parent for payment, without interest, of such Milestone Payment Amount (subject to abandoned property, escheat or other similar Laws).

 

(f)                                   If any Milestone Payment Amount (or portion thereof) remains unclaimed by a Holder two (2) years after the applicable Milestone Payment Date (or immediately prior to such earlier date on which such Milestone Payment Amount would otherwise escheat to or become the property of any Governmental Authority), such Milestone Payment Amount (or portion thereof) will, to the extent permitted by applicable Law, become the property of Parent and will be transferred to Parent or a person nominated in writing by Parent (with written notice thereof from Parent to the Rights Agent), free and clear of all claims or interest of any Person previously entitled thereto, and no consideration or compensation shall be payable therefor.  Neither Parent nor the Rights Agent will be liable to any Person in respect of any Milestone Payment Amount delivered to a public official pursuant to any applicable abandoned property, escheat or similar legal requirement under applicable Law.

 

Section 2.5                                    No Voting, Dividends or Interest; No Equity or Ownership Interest.

 

(a)                                 CVRs will not have any voting or dividend rights, and interest will not accrue on any amounts payable in respect of CVRs.

 

(b)                                 CVRs will not represent any equity or ownership interest in Parent, any constituent company to the Merger, or any of their respective Subsidiaries (including the Surviving Corporation).  The sole right of each Holder to receive property hereunder is the right to receive the Milestone Payment Amount, if any, in accordance with the terms hereof.  It is hereby acknowledged and agreed that a CVR shall not constitute a security of Parent, any constituent company to the Merger, or any of their respective Subsidiaries (including the Surviving Corporation).

 

Section 2.6                                    Ability to Abandon CVR.

 

A Holder may at any time, at such Holder’s option, abandon all of such Holder’s remaining rights represented by CVRs by transferring such CVR to Parent or a person nominated in writing by Parent (with written notice thereof from Parent to the Rights Agent) without consideration in compensation therefor, and such rights will be cancelled, with the Rights Agent being promptly notified in writing by Parent of such Transfer and cancellation.  Nothing in this Agreement is intended to prohibit Parent or any of its Affiliates from offering to acquire or acquiring CVRs, in private transactions or otherwise, for consideration in its sole discretion. Section 4.3                                    Audits.

 

(a)                                 Upon the reasonable written request of the Holders’ Representative delivered to Parent within thirty (30) days of the date on which the Holders are delivered a Milestone Non-Achievement Certificate for a Sales Measurement Period and the Net Sales Statement for such Sales Measurement Period pursuant to Section 2.4(b) of this Agreement (the “Review Request Period”), Parent shall provide, and shall cause its Affiliates to provide, the Independent Accountant with access upon reasonable notice and during normal business hours to such records of Parent or its Affiliates the Independent Accountant may reasonably require to verify the accuracy of the statements set forth in the Net Sales Statement accompanying such Milestone Non-Achievement Certificate and the figures underlying the calculations set forth therein, including any work papers and other documents and information related to such Net Sales Statement as the Independent Accountant may request and as are available to Parent or its Affiliates. The fees charged by the Independent Accountant shall be paid by Parent. The Independent Accountant shall disclose to the Holders’ Representative any matters directly related to their findings and shall disclose whether it has determined that any statements set forth in such Net Sales Statements are incorrect. The Independent Accountant shall provide Parent with a copy of all disclosures made to the Holders’ Representative.

 

(b)                                 No later than thirty (30) days following initial access to such records of Parent as described in Section 4.3(a), the Independent Accountant shall deliver a written report to Parent and the Holders’ Representative of its preliminary findings regarding whether it has determined that any statements set forth in the applicable Net Sales Statement are incorrect and whether the Milestone occurred during the applicable Sales Measurement Period, including any information directly related to their findings (the “Preliminary Shortfall Report”). Parent and the Holders’ Representative shall have forty-five (45) days following receipt of the Preliminary Shortfall Report from the Independent Accountant (the “Preliminary Shortfall Report Review Period”) to review and comment upon the Preliminary Shortfall Report. The Independent Accountant shall take into consideration in good faith any comments received from Parent or the Holders’ Representative during the Preliminary Shortfall Report Review Period. No later than ten (10) Business Days after the expiration of the Preliminary Shortfall Report Review Period, the Independent Accountant shall deliver a final written report to Parent and the Holders’ Representative (the “Final Shortfall Report”). If the Independent Accountant in the Final Shortfall Report concludes that the Milestone Payment should have been paid but was not paid when due, then no later than sixty (60) days following its receipt of the Final Shortfall Report, (i) Parent shall deliver to the Rights Agent the aggregate amount of the Milestone Payment Amount payable to each Holder, plus interest on such amount at the Shortfall Interest Rate from the date the Milestone Payment Date should have occurred to the date of actual delivery of such amount to the Rights Agent (such amount, including interest, being the “CVR Shortfall Amount”), and (ii) the Rights Agent shall promptly (and in any event within ten (10) Business Days after the date on which the aggregate CVR Shortfall Amount is delivered to the Rights Agent) (A) mail each Holder, by first-class postage prepaid mail, a notification setting forth the Independent Accountant’s determination, and (B) pay or cause to be paid to each Holder, by check mailed to

 

16


 

the address of each Holder set forth in the CVR Register as of the close of business on the date on which the aggregate CVR Shortfall Amount is delivered to the Rights Agent, the CVR Shortfall Amount payable to such Holder, less any applicable withholding pursuant to Section 2.4(d). If the Independent Accountant in the Final Shortfall Report concludes that the Milestone Payment should have not been paid, (i) Parent shall promptly notify the Rights Agent of such determination, and (ii) the Rights Agent shall promptly (and in any event within ten (10) Business Days after the date on which such notification is delivered to the Rights Agent), mail each Holder, by first-class postage prepaid mail, a notification setting forth the Independent Accountant’s determination.  The Final Shortfall Report shall be final, conclusive and binding on Parent and the Holders, shall be non-appealable and shall not be subject to further review, absent manifest error.

 

(c)                                  Each Person seeking to receive information from Parent in connection with a review or audit pursuant to this Section 4.3 shall enter into, and shall cause its accounting firm to enter into, a reasonable and mutually satisfactory confidentiality agreement with Parent obligating such party to retain all such financial information disclosed to such party in confidence pursuant to such confidentiality agreement and not use such information for any purpose other than the completion of such review or audit.

 

(d)                                 Parent shall not, and shall cause its Affiliates not to, enter into any license or distribution agreement with any third party (other than Parent or its Affiliates) with respect to a Product unless such agreement contains provisions that would allow any Independent Accountant appointed pursuant to this Section 4.3 such access to the records of the other party to such license or distribution agreement as may be reasonably necessary to perform its duties pursuant to this Section 4.3; provided, however, that Parent and its Affiliates shall not be required to amend any of its existing licenses or distribution agreements.

 

(e)                                  If, upon the expiration of the applicable Review Request Period, the Acting Holders have not requested a review of the applicable Net Sales Statement in accordance with this Section 4.3, the calculations set forth in such Net Sales Statement shall be binding and conclusive upon the Holders.

 

Section 4.4                                    Diligent Efforts.

 

Commencing upon the Closing Date, Parent shall use, and shall cause each applicable other Selling Entity to use, Diligent Efforts to cause the Milestone to occur during each Sale Measurement Period. Without limiting the foregoing, neither Parent nor its Affiliates shall act in bad faith for the purpose of avoiding the occurrence of the Milestone during any Sale Measurement Period.

Section 6.3                                    Product Transfer.

 

If Parent or any of its Affiliates, directly or indirectly, by a sale, merger, joint venture, lease, license or any other transaction or arrangement, sells, transfers, conveys or otherwise disposes of their respective rights in and to any Product to a third party (other than Parent or any of its Subsidiaries), then the Milestone shall be deemed to have occurred for all purposes under this Agreement as of the consummation of the transaction or arrangement involving such sale, transfer, conveyance or other disposition; provided, that this Section 6.3 shall not be applicable to a Parent Sale Transaction. For the purposes of clarification, and subject to Section 4.4, Parent may use contract research organizations, contract manufacturing organizations, contract sales organizations, subcontractors and distributors in the ordinary course of business to perform research, development, manufacturing and commercialization activities (including granting an appropriate non-exclusive license or sublicense to the extent necessary), without triggering the Milestone.

Section 8.12                             Termination.

 

This Agreement will automatically terminate and be of no further force or effect and, except as provided in Section 3.2, the parties hereto will have no further liability hereunder, and the CVRs will expire without any consideration or compensation therefor, upon the earlier to occur of (a) the receipt of payment of the Milestone Payment Amount by all Holders pursuant to Section 2.4, (b) the date that follows the expiration of the Review Request Period related to the expiration of the Second Sales Measurement Period (provided no written request is received during any Review Request Period pursuant to Section 4.3), or (c) if a written request is received during the Review Request Period following the expiration of the Second Sales Measurement Period, the later of (i) the date that the Final Shortfall Report is delivered to Parent and the Holders, or (ii) if applicable, the receipt of payment of the CVR Shortfall Amount by all Holders, in each case, pursuant to Section 4.3.  The termination of this Agreement will not affect or limit the right of Holders to receive the Milestone Payment Amount under Section 2.4 (or the CVR Shortfall Amount under Section 4.3, as applicable) to the extent earned prior to the termination of this Agreement, and the provisions applicable thereto will survive the expiration or termination of this Agreement.
